A match of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ye reads as a warm, medium-deep orange-brown with a golden amber cast. It has enough chroma to feel distinct, but the lower LRV keeps it grounded rather than bright, so it tends to read as earthy and substantial.

MyPerfectColor custom spray paint matched to the selected Sherwin-Williams color reference can be used on vents, switch plates, speaker grilles, railings, mailboxes, brackets, shelving, hardware, and small furniture accents when you want those parts to carry the same warm brown-orange reference. It is also practical for PVC trim pieces, shutters, or removable fixture components that need a repeatable color match.

Because the color has noticeable depth and saturation, finish and substrate can change how strong the amber-brown reads. Spray application over darker or uneven surfaces may need more than one coat for even color, while gloss and texture can make surface flaws or sheen differences more visible. Outdoor exposure can also be harder on richer colors, so surface prep and full film build matter.

How should I spray apply SW6362 Tigereye for smoother results?

For SW6362 Tigereye in spray form, use light, even coats and keep the can moving. Hold a consistent distance, overlap each pass slightly, and build coverage with multiple coats instead of one heavy coat.

Heavy passes can cause runs, uneven sheen, or a muddy color build. This matters most on small parts, trim pieces, hardware, vents, or other items where the finish is easy to see.

Why can SW6362 Tigereye look different after I apply a MyPerfectColor match?

Even after you order a match of SW6362 Tigereye, the finished result can read differently depending on lighting, placement, sheen, texture, and the surfaces around it. The color reference stays the same, but the applied finish is still affected by its environment.

For that reason, judge the painted part in the actual location and under the light it will normally see. A color that looks correct in one setting can appear warmer, duller, or stronger in another.

Can SW6362 Tigereye be used on plastic parts, and what prep should I expect?

Plastics vary widely, so test SW6362 Tigereye on the actual part before painting a finished item. MyPerfectColor spray paint sticks well to most plastics, but prep and primer can matter a lot on difficult or low-energy surfaces.

Using the MyPerfectColor primer for Acrylic Enamel can help improve adhesion. For the primer product page, see primer for Acrylic Enamel. Clean the surface well and follow the prep steps for the specific plastic you are coating.

What are the RGB, HEX and LRV values for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ye?
The RGB values for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ye are 189, 119, 71 and the HEX code is #BD7747. The LRV for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ye is 24.46. The LRV stands for Light Reflectance Value and measures the percentage of light that a color reflects. Learn more about Light Reflectance Values and using RGB and Hex codes for paint.
What is the Hue Angle and Chroma for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ye?
The Hue Angle for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ye is 59.01 and the chroma is 43.64. The Hue Angle represents the position of a color's hue around a color wheel. The Chromacity represents the intensity of a hue. Learn more about browsing colors by hue.

How much area will one spray can cover? And what is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ye spray paint made of?

To make spray paint matched to Sherwin Williams SW6362 Tigereye. MyPerfectColor uses an acrylic enamel which is a fast-drying durable coating suitable for interior or exterior use. MyPerfectColor custom spray paint enables you to conveniently achieve a professional spray-smooth finish in any color in any sheen. It sticks well to most surfaces including metal, plastics, powder-coatings, cabinets and primed or previously painted wood.

The 11oz spray will cover about 20 square feet per coat. Keep in mind that it is difficult to gauge how much spray you'll need as it is highly dependent on how it is applied. It is better to have too much than run short.
